Yeah, the problem here isn't the nondisclosure, it's that people tie acceptability as a trans person to "passing" and hold that over our heads. Putting this in scare quotes because passing as it is commonly understood doesn't mean "looks like a cis woman", but "meets a conventional, cishetnormative standard of beauty women are subjected to." What people in this comment chain rightfully complain about would have been thrown at them regardless of Finnster's hormone status, because it's just plain old transmisogyny. We've been judged by how fuckable we are to cishet dudes since at least the days of Ray Blanchard, when that consideration *was a direct part of if we were allowed to take HRT in the first place."
